At Proxima Fusion, we're driven by a bold mission – to redefine the future of sustainable energy. Our unique concept, built upon the groundbreaking W7-X stellarator and the latest advances in technology, paves the way for commercially viable fusion power plants.
What’s more, our work in stellarator optimization, powered by cutting‑edge computation and machine learning, is propelling us into uncharted territories of fusion technology. New higher performance design points are unlocked by high temperature superconducting magnets.

You will contribute to the design of Proxima Fusion’s Stellarator Model Coil (SMC), including the mechanical design of key systems, components and assemblies comprising both the SMC, as well as the equipment and tooling required to manufacture it. You will participate in the development of prototyping & testing plans, potentially participate in the physical testing of new designs, concepts and materials and develop the mechanical designs for novel tooling, equipment, and manufacturing processes.
As a mechanical design engineer, you will have a key role in the design, delivery and implementation of mechanical equipment, to enable ongoing research & development, as well as the manufacturing scale‑up of the magnet components, systems, and associated tooling and equipment. You will also work with external collaborators and suppliers to develop designs, equipment, systems and materials.
